Administrative Assistant
Nak Nu We Sha
Department of Human Services
Hourly Wage: $15.74-$17.72/Regular/Full-Time
Administrative Assistant performs a variety of technical administrative office support work for the Yakama Nation Nak Nu We Sha (NNWS)/Kinship program. Responsible to set up and initiate extensive electronic confidential record management system for NNWS files/Kinship Files. Follow programs procedures and guideline in the disposition of confidential files. Works with all staff to ensure accurate preparation of documents. Administrative Assistant answers directs or forward general phone inquiries using a professional and courteous manner. Replies to general information requests with accurate information. Greets visitors to organization in a professional and friendly manner. Ensures the efficient day-to-day operation of the office by providing clerical office support with processing and organizing work flow. Provide assistance with preparing casework document and client files. Supports the work of supervisor/management and other staff. The Administrative Assistant may be required to work some overtime hours if necessary.
